depends on how you define the best. eotech makes the best of the open top red dots where as aimpoint is the best of the closed tube models. open tops obstruct less view but if the diode is dirty you wont get a clean image. closed tubes are much tougher but obstruct ALOT of the view. i have only really used burris speed bead and the bushnell holosight. both were ok but after a while they both seemed to flicker after every shot.
